Police say a car crashed into a tree on Grantham Avenue
Tragedy on the streets of St. Catharines after a single vehicle crash.
Police were called to a serious collision on Grantham Avenue, near Scott Street, late yesterday afternoon, to find a car had crashed into a tree.
Police say the driver of the black 2009 Dodge Caliber, a 77-year old man from St. Catharines, was seriously hurt.
Despite attempts to save him, police say the man was pronounced dead at hospital.
The road was re-opened late last night.
Police are asking for witnesses to call them, including if you have dashcam video of the crash.
